UC Health is hiring a full-time Night Shift Clinical Supervisor for the Acute Care Cardiology unit at University of Cincinnati Medical Center.

The Clinical Supervisor will support the Medical Center's 6NW floor for acute care cardiology, delivering high-quality care to patients based on assessed needs, established standards of care and according to policy and procedures.

About UC Medical Center

As the pioneering hospital of UC Health, Greater Cincinnati's academic health system, UC Medical Center has served greater Cincinnati and Northern Kentucky for nearly 200 years. Each year, hundreds of thousands of patients receive care from our world-renowned clinicians and care teams utilizing the most advanced medical knowledge and technology available. UC Medical Center has 724 licensed beds and more than 5,800 employees.

Responsibilities

The Clinical Registered Nurse (RN) Supervisor is an individual who holds a current state license to practice nursing. The Clinical Registered Nurse (RN) Supervisor requires knowledge regarding operational leadership of shift including patient flow and assignment/adjustment of resources to meet dynamic changing needs throughout the shift. The Clinical RN Supervisor will actively identify opportunities for improvement in patient satisfaction, perform trials and report back to leadership on results.

  • Supervises staff assigned to their unit or center of excellence and demonstrates the ability to coach and mentor staff.
  • Leads and implements operational improvement initiatives and assures compliance via staff coaching and mentoring.
  • Identifies needs for specific equipment and ensures adequate and properly functioning equipment and supplies are available for patient care.
  • Ensures shift practice is in compliance with state and federal medical laws (EMTALA, HIPAA and House Bill 316).
  • Maintains hospital wide and department specific nursing competencies and completes annual competencies in required time frame.
  • Collaborates with the Department Educator and/or provides for orientation and educational needs identified in the department.
  • Actively involved and engages staff in departmental performance improvement (PI) activities according to department PI plan.
  • Provides immediate counseling for staff when specific behaviors or incidents negatively affect patient care or the general work environment. Write up incidents.
